All it takes to run an Ubuntu Hour is to create an event on the LoCo Portal and let the mailing list know, then go to your favorite coffee shop or restaurant and hang out for an hour. People show up, and that's your Ubuntu Hour. There are some handy Ubuntu logo tabletop standups so people can find your table without asking awkward questions: https://wiki.ubuntu.com/CanadianTeam/standups
